Embodiment Construction

[0024] Specific embodiments of the present invention will be described in detail below in conjunction with the accompanying drawings.

[0025] figure 1 is a schematic cross-sectional view of the backlight module provided in the embodiment. Such as figure 1 As shown, the backlight module used in this embodiment includes a light source 11 , a diffusion plate 12 , a reflection plate 13 and a diffuse reflection layer 14 .

[0026] The diffuser plate 12 and the reflector plate 13 are laminated and arranged in close contact; the reflector plate 13 is provided with a concave curved surface facing the light-incident surface of the diffuser plate 12, and the surface of the concave curved surface is a diffuse reflection surface. Abstract

The invention provides a backlight module and an LCD, wherein the backlight module comprises a light source, a diffusion plate and a reflection plate; the reflection plate is attached to the light-insurface side of the diffusion plate; the reflection plat comprises a concave curved surface which faces the light-in surface side of the diffusion plate and is a diffuse reflection surface; an accommodation cavity is formed between the concave curved surface and the light-in surface of the diffusion plate; the light source is arranged in the accommodation cavity and attached to the incident lightsurface of the diffusion plate; light sent by the light source is cast to the concave curved surface. With the adoption of the backlight module, the light source is directly arranged on the back surface of the diffusion plate, the light is reflected by a diffuse reflection layer, and the incident light to the diffusion late is uniform. Compared with the backlight modules in the prior art, a lightguide plate is not required, the thickness and the layer structure numbers of the backlight module are reduced.

technical field [0001] The invention relates to the technical field of liquid crystal display, in particular to a backlight module and a liquid crystal display using the aforementioned backlight module. Background technique [0002] The liquid crystal display uses the change of the state of the liquid crystal to control the luminous flux incident from the side of the backlight module to realize the change of the displayed content. In practical applications, the consistency of light intensity at various places in the backlight module affects the quality of the liquid crystal display, especially the color consistency of the same color when all parts of the liquid crystal display are lit. It is an important direction for improving the quality of liquid crystal displays. [0003] Based on the consideration of the consistency of the emitted light from the backlight module, the backlight modules currently used by most manufacturers are edge-light backlight modules.
